LET-2, 2" SPHERICAL TE PROPORTIONAL COUNTER


The FWT LET-2 is a spherical tissue equivalent (TE) proportional counter suitable for measuring the spectra of absorbed dose in LET (actually P[Y] spectra). It is based upon designs originated by Dr. H. H. Rossi of Columbia University and uses a spiral grid for uniform collection characteristics.

The detector is housed in a 0.060 inch-thick aluminum shell which serves as a vacuum tight housing. The aluminum shell is thus watertight, but the electrical connectors are not. The aluminum shell is grounded electrically and is sturdy enough to allow direct clamping.

The counter is designed to be evacuated and filled by the user with TE proportional counting gas (either propane or methane based) at a low pressure, typically 1 to 20 cm Hg. These low pressures enable the spherical detector to simulate small tissue volumes from less than 1 to more than 8 microns in diameter.

  Spectral Measurements
Connection of the detector to a preamplifier and a linear amplifier will enable a P (Y) spectrum to be accumulated on a pulse height analyzer when the detector is exposed to a radiation source. Proper choice of amplifier gain settings will enable data to be obtained for Y values from 0.5 to 1000 keV per micron. These data may be converted to a spectrum of absorbed dose in LET with the aid of specific software.

The optional internal Cm244 alpha source makes calibration of the Y axis in keV per micron particularly simple. The source allows collimated alpha particles to cross the detector on a diameter, producing a peak in the pulse height analyzer display. The peak channel is characteristic of the average keV per micron expended by the alpha particles in traversing the sphere. The alpha source has a gravity-operated shutter mechanism that allows operation free of unwanted alpha counts when desired.

  Specifications
Tissue-Equivalent (TE) Plastic Sphere: Wall thickness, 0 .1 25 inch (0-318 cm); inside diameter, 2.24 inch (5.69 cm); Shonka Type A-150 plastic, 1.12 9/CM3.
Gas Filling Requirements: TE proportional counting gas; 1.17cm Hg of TE gas of density 1.062 g/liter corresponds to a cavity of 1 micron diameter; gas must be made up of high purity components and be moisture free.
Gas Filling: Bellows seal valve, Connector mates with Swagelok O-QC4-D-400
Signal Output: Suitable for use directly into a low noise preamplifier. Output is AC coupled.
Signal Connector: Mates with BNC UG260 B/U or equiv.
High Voltage Requirements: Positive polarity, @700 volts at 1 .17 cm Hg, @750 volts at 2.0 cm Hg.
High Voltage Connector: MHV, Mates with UG932 A/U or equiv.
Optional Internal Source: CM244, ~0.3 microcuries; average alpha energy ~5.80 meV; gravity operated shutter.
Exterior Can: Vacuum tight aluminum; wall thickness, 0.060 inch (0. 152 cm) , grounded to serve as electrostatic shield, maximum O.D. of detector 3.62 inches.
Overall Size and Weight: Length including vacuum connector: 6.125 inches (15.5 cm) ; weight, 560 grams
Calibration: Includes a graph of the detectors alpha peak and a graph of Cf252 spectra.
